* UnintentionalPeriodPiece: Even though [[IntimateTelecommunications erotic services]] over [[UsefulNotes/NineHundredNumber 900/976 numbers]] [[https://www.cnbc.com/2016/01/25/remember-naughty-1-900-numbers-lines-are-still-open.html still exist today]], they are not as prominent as they used to be, as there have been changes in both [[SocietyMarchesOn law]] and [[TechnologyMarchesOn technology]]. First of all, most 900 numbers are now blocked by default, so phone sex companies now use 800 numbers, then charge their fees via credit card. Also, Kramer now has other options, such as cam girls online. In fact, if the episode were filmed today, an equivalent scene would be Jerry chastising Kramer for the latter piggybacking on the former's Wi-Fi while going to cam girl websites (here, as in the actual episode, implicitely to avoid a ShockinglyExpensiveBill).
